If the bridge reports `auth-expired`, do not simply restart the service; the upstream Fieldledger broker will lock the client after three failed handshakes, and unlocking requires a ticket to the platform team. Instead, rotate the broker credential through the Fieldledger console, then update the gateway's environment file at `/etc/harrowline/.env` so it contains the following line:

sealed setting: RELAY_SECRET13=bca49b02a6971

## SQL Linting

All SQL files in the Bramblewick repos are checked by `sqlwarden` in CI. The ruleset forbids `SELECT *`, requires explicit column lists in inserts, and enforces snake_case identifiers. Run `sqlwarden check migrations/` locally before pushing. The linter also validates referenced tables against the live schema catalog, which it reads using the connection string below.

primary connection of yagep-kahip = redis://giliel_svc:zYiKsLL2PLpfPL@db-348f.xolmarsys.corp:5432/fenwyn

### Audit Item 14 — Consent Banner Rollout (Pebblecast SDK)

Verify that the consent banner shipped in the Pebblecast SDK v4 rollout is present on every surface where a plugin collects usage signals. External plugin authors must confirm the banner renders before any data call, that dismissal is persisted, and that no tracking fires pre-consent. Attach screenshots for each supported locale to the audit record. Evidence is complete only once countersigned by the rollout owner named below.

named custodian: Brivan Eliath Quenox Frador